バージョン選択

フォーラム

メニュー

オンライン状況

35 人のユーザが現在オンラインです。 (20 人のユーザが フォーラム を参照しています。)
登録ユーザ: 0
ゲスト: 35
もっと...

サイト内検索

バグ報告 > 管理機能 > 【Ver.1.4.6】商品の更新ができない

管理機能

新規スレッドを追加する

スレッド表示 | 新しいものから 前のトピック | 次のトピック | 下へ
投稿者 スレッド
ゲスト
投稿日時: 2008/1/24 18:12
対応状況: −−−
【Ver.1.4.6】商品の更新ができない
はじめまして。

アイルのiクラスタ(i-04)で
Ver.1.4.6を使用してサイトを構築中なのですが、
管理画面で商品の編集を行い、確認画面で
[>>この内容で登録する]
を押した後に画面が真っ白な状態になってしまいます。
新規の登録は問題なくできています。

db_err.logのほうを見てみると、


SELECT * FROM vw_products_nonclass AS noncls  WHERE product_id = '3'    [nativecode=ERROR:  current transaction is aborted, commands ignored until end of transaction block]

といったエラーが残っていました。

ソースのほうを追ってみると
product.phpの中のlfRegistProductの

		// 削除要求のあった既存ファイルの削除
		$arrRet = lfGetProduct($arrList['product_id']);
		$objUpFile->deleteDBFile($arrRet);


のあたりで引っかかっていたようなので、
ここを暫定処置でコメントアウトして作業をしています。

これはなにか環境に由来する現象でしょうか?

EC-CUBEバージョン  1.4.6
PHPバージョン PHP 4.4.2
DBバージョン PostgreSQL 7.4.13
ゲスト
投稿日時: 2008/1/29 18:05
対応状況: 解決済
Re: 【Ver.1.4.6】商品の更新ができない
自己レスになりますが解決いたしました。

ローカルのmySQL環境で検証していた際に
SC_DbConn.php
の中で文字化け対策に追記した

		$buf = $objDbConn->prepare('SET NAMES ujis');
		$objDbConn->execute($buf);

が本番環境上では引っかかっていたためでした。

お騒がせいたしましたm( __ __ )m
スレッド表示 | 新しいものから 前のトピック | 次のトピック | トップ


 



ログイン



統計情報

総メンバー数は75,125名です
総投稿数は104,370件です

投稿数ランキング

1
seasoft
7333
2
468
3217
3
AMUAMU
2712
4
nanasess
2202
5
umebius
2085
6
yuh
1664
7
red
1535
8
h_tanaka
1189
9
tsuji
942
10
fukap
907
11
shutta
835
12
tao_s
794
13 ramrun 789
14 karin 689
15 sumida 641
16
homan
633
17 DELIGHT 572
18
patapata
502
19
flealog
485
20 tonton 437
Copyright© EC-CUBE CO.,LTD. All Rights Reserved.